Autism Diagnostic Observation Timetable

The Autism Diagnostic Observation Schedule (ADOS) evaluation might be a additional preferred Software for diagnosing Autism Spectrum Problem (ASD). Used by psychologists, pediatricians, together with other skilled experts, ADOS supplies a standardized implies for analyzing social conversation, interaction, Perform, and repetitive behaviors—all significant places troubled with autism. The ADOS evaluation is definitely an observational exam which usually takes under consideration anyone's purely natural behaviors and responses, offering an in-depth comprehension of whether or not they fulfill the diagnostic standards for autism.

The ADOS evaluation contains diverse modules tailored in the direction of the age and conversation level of the individual staying assessed. You will find 4 most important modules, Each individual designed for certain developmental levels and talents. By way of example, Module one is for little young children with negligible verbal techniques, while Module 4 would do the job for adults and adolescents with fluent speech. This flexibility signifies that the ADOS can properly seize autistic characteristics throughout different ages and skills.

Every ADOS session encompasses a compilation of structured and semi-structured routines that deliver the read more chance to notice quite a few social and interaction behaviors. These functions are made being engaging nonetheless delicate, permitting assessors to observe all-natural responses to social cues, psychological expression, and imaginative play. For instance, a youngster may be provided a toy and observed on how they Perform, share, or have interaction the assessor, which could reveal crucial insights about their social and conversation expertise. In older individuals, conversational skills, responses to social questions, and non-verbal conversation are closely noticed.

The ADOS is actually a important portion of a broader autism assessment and it can be generally combined with other diagnostic equipment, one example is the Autism Diagnostic Job interview-Revised (ADI-R), which gathers additional information from mothers and fathers or caregivers about the individual's developmental history. By combining these Views, the ADOS offers a robust, multi-dimensional examine actions, interaction, and social conversation.

ADOS scoring is determined by unique requirements, permitting the assessor to look for the possibility of autism. The scoring considers many behavioral indicators, that may be then mapped towards the ADOS diagnostic algorithm. A diagnosis just isn't specified entirely determined by the ADOS rating; alternatively, it performs a task in a thorough diagnostic analysis that includes observations, interviews, and developmental historical past.

General, the ADOS evaluation is usually a important Resource inside prognosis of autism since it delivers an aim, structured framework for comprehending a person’s social and communicative talents. Its structured solution assists clinicians recognize autism early and precisely, supporting timely intervention that could come up with a profound distinction in the individual’s progress and top quality of everyday living.
